The Gardener's A-Z Guide to Growing Organic Food
765 varieties of vegetables, herbs, fruits, and nuts. Formulas and techniques that control 201 pests and deseases organically.
By Tanya Denckla

"The Gardener's A-Z Guide to Growing Organic Food" is published by Storey Books in 2003 - North Adams, MA, it has 485 pages and the language of the book is English.
